Description

Summary
The Scientist I supports laboratory process development activities focused on downstream processing of vaccine process intermediates. This role is responsible for executing laboratory experiments, preparing reagents and solutions, performing purification activities, monitoring process performance, and documenting results in accordance with Good Laboratory Practices (GLP). The ideal candidate is a motivated early-career scientist with strong laboratory fundamentals, excellent attention to detail, and the ability to work both independently and collaboratively in a dynamic research environment.


Responsibilities

  • Set up and operate process equipment for laboratory-scale experiments.
  • Prepare laboratory reagents, solutions, and media to support process development activities.
  • Perform laboratory-scale downstream processing of vaccine process intermediates.
  • Execute process monitoring assays and analyze test results.
  • Collect, organize, track, and report experimental data to client and project team members.
  • Maintain accurate laboratory records and documentation in accordance with Good Laboratory Practices (GLP).
  • Document experimental work clearly and ensure testing is performed accurately and consistently.
  • Communicate results, observations, and project updates effectively to team members and stakeholders.
  • Work independently while supporting team objectives and project timelines.
  • Follow laboratory safety procedures, company policies, and established operating procedures.
